How to do Dumbbell Over Bench Neutral Wrist Curl
- Sit on a bench with your feet flat on the ground and hold a dumbbell in each hand, palms facing up.
- Rest your forearms on the bench, allowing your wrists to hang off the edge.
- Keeping your upper arms stationary, exhale and curl the dumbbells up towards your shoulders.
- Pause for a moment at the top, then inhale and slowly lower the dumbbells back down to the starting position.
- Repeat for the desired number of repetitions.
Dumbbell Over Bench Neutral Wrist Curl Sets and Reps by Goal
Strength
3 sets of 5-6 reps with 2-3 minutes of rest. Size up only when both sides finish equally strong.
Hypertrophy
3 sets of 10-12 reps with 90 seconds of rest. Start each set with the weaker arm and match it.
Endurance
2-3 sets of 15-18 reps with 45-60 seconds of rest. Add reps on the smaller bell before you size up.
